### Job overview

The NHS Talking Therapies Service in East and South East Hertfordshire, covering Welwyn, Ware, Bishops Stortford and surrounding towns and villages,  is looking to employ an Assistant Psychologist.

The Assistant Psychologist plays a central role in ensuring our service is of the best quality, with the best outcomes for our service users.

Hertfordshire was one of the original 11 Pathfinder sites for the development of Talking Therapies Services, commencing in 2007/8 and has since developed through 1st and 2nd wave expansion sites to provide a well  resourced and innovative Talking Therapies service across the whole of the county. Our Trust has been awarded ‘Outstanding’ status by the Care quality Commission and our Talking Therapies Service is APPS accredited.

### Main duties of the job

The role of the Assistant Psychologist in ESE Talking Therapies is to support the work of staff in the Primary Care Service, including providing psychological assessment and interventions under the supervision of a qualified Psychologist or CBT therapist. To assist in audit and data collection and the development of research and innovation projects. To work independently according to a plan agreed with a qualified Psychologist and within the overall framework of HPFT’s policies and procedures.

## Person Specification

### PREVIOUS EXPERIENCE

**Essential**

- Experience of work with people with mental health problems.
- Understanding of and compliance with relevant professional standards and practice.
- Experience of using computers for data analysis, especially Excel and SPSS for Windows.
- High standard of report writing.
- An understanding of the needs and difficulties of people with common mental health problems.
- An ability to apply existing psychological knowledge to a primary care context.

**Desirable**

- Experience of working in Primary Care Services.
- Experience and knowledge of undertaking audit in clinical services.

### QUALIFICATIONS/EDUCATION/TRAINING

**Essential**

- An honours degree or higher in Psychology. Entitlement to graduate membership of the British Psychological Society.

**Desirable**

- Further post graduate training in relevant areas of professional psychology, mental health practice or research design and analysis
